1908 Quarter, Multicolor PR68
Ex: John C. Hugon Collection

1908 25C PR68 ★ NGC. Ex: Hugon. Concentric bands of orange-gold, powder-blue, and apple-green dominate the obverse. The reverse border shows golden-brown and aquamarine at the margin though the frosty eagle and nearby glassy field are untoned. A prize for the connoisseur of patinated silver proofs, this Star-Designated 1908 Barber quarter is tied for the finest non-Cameo proofs known. It is mainly the toning that keeps this piece from a Cameo designation, as the silvery central reverse shows moderate contrast between the eagle and the field. The strike is full throughout. Census: 1 in 68 , none finer with a Star designation, 1 finer as PR69 Cameo (11/12).
